Abstract
In color TV broadcasting standards, such as NTSC and PAL, the limited bandwidth of the chrominance signals produces relatively slow chrominance transitions, causing smeared color edges in the received images. In this paper, we present an adaptive color transient improvement algorithm for enhancing color edge transition of images. By using a local image feature dependent gain control function to adaptively control the enhancement of the color transient, the proposed algorithm produces steeper natural color edge transitions and prevents the overshoot effects and the amplification of the noise.
